Survey Says Millennials Use Alternative Financial Services Regardless of Income Level

A study released by Think Finance surveyed 640 Millennials who have used some type of alternative financial services product within the last year and earn less than $75,000 in annual income. A new survey of underbanked Millennials – 18-34 year olds who supplement their bank accounts with alternative financial services such as prepaid debit cards or check cashing – challenges the stereotype of alternative financial service users as the poorest members of society who are forced to turn to alternative products.
